The traditional 3-stage model of life–education, work, retirement–is giving way to a non-linear multi-stage lifestyle (Palette of Life model) where people will cycle in and out of education, work, leisure, recreation, sabbatical, gig economy, and encore careers. And this new cyclical lifestyle will require significant changes in the nature of financial planning and the role of “saving for retirement.”
